void swap(int* a, int* b)
{
int temp = *a;
*a = *b;
*b = temp;
}
void quicksort(int* arr,int start,int end)
{
if (start >= end) return;
int left = start;
int right = end;
int mid = arr[(start + end)/2];
do
{
while (arr[left] < mid) left++;
while (arr[right] > mid) right--;
if (left <= right)
{
swap(&arr[left], &arr[right]);
left++;
right--;
}
} while (left<=right);
quicksort(arr,start, right);
quicksort(arr,left,end);
}
